Transitional etc provisions associated with Act or
amendments
Statutes Amendment (Police) Act 2013,
Sch 1
1—Transitional provisions
(1) Section 27 of the Police Act 1998, as amended by
Part 2 of this Act, applies to an appointment—
(a) made on or after the commencement of this clause; or
(b) made prior to the commencement of this clause if the period of
probation for the appointment has not ended before that commencement.
(2) Section 55 of the Police Act 1998, as amended by
Part 2 of this Act, applies to a selection process conducted after the
commencement of this clause.
Statutes Amendment (South Australian Employment
Tribunal) Act 2016
127—Transitional provisions
(1) In this section—
principal Act means the Police
Act 1998;
relevant day means the day on which this Part comes into
operation;
SAET means the South Australian Employment
Tribunal.
(2) A decision, direction or order of the Police Review Tribunal under
Part 8 Division 1 or 2 of the principal Act in force immediately before the
relevant day will, on and from the relevant day, be taken to be a decision,
direction or order of SAET.
(3) A right to apply to the Police Review Tribunal under Part 8 Division 1
or 2 of the principal Act in existence before the relevant day (but not
exercised before that day) will be exercised as if this Part had been in
operation before the right arose, so that the relevant proceedings may be
commenced before SAET rather than the Police Review Tribunal.
(4) Any proceedings before the Police Review Tribunal under Part 8
Division 1 or 2 of the principal Act immediately before the relevant day will,
subject to such directions as the President of SAET thinks fit, be transferred
to SAET where they may proceed as if they had been commenced before
SAET.
(5) SAET may—
(a) receive in evidence any transcript of evidence in proceedings before
the Police Review Tribunal, and draw any conclusions of fact from that evidence
that appear proper; and
(b) adopt any findings or determinations of the Police Review Tribunal
that may be relevant to proceedings before SAET; and
(c) adopt or make any decision (including a decision in the nature of a
determination), direction or order in relation to proceedings before the Police
Review Tribunal before the relevant day (including so as to make a decision or
determination, or a direction or order, in relation to proceedings fully heard
before the relevant day); and
(d) take other steps to promote or ensure the smoothest possible
transition from 1 jurisdiction to another in connection with the operation
of this section.
Police Complaints and Discipline Act 2016, Sch 1
Pt 16—Transitional provisions
53—Certain orders of Commissioner etc under
repealed Act taken to be valid
For the purposes of the law of the State, the following actions purportedly
ordered or taken under section 40 of the Police Act 1998 or a
corresponding previous enactment in respect of a member of SA Police will be
taken to be valid, and always to have been valid:
(a) a reduction in rank of the member;
(b) a reduction in the seniority of the member.
Statutes Amendment and Repeal (Budget Measures)
Act 2021, Pt 15—Savings and transitional
provisions
56—Continuation
of appointments of protective security officers
(1) An appointment
of a person who was, immediately before the commencement of this section, a
protective security officer under the Protective Security Act 2007
will, on the commencement of this section and subject to the Police
Act 1998 (as amended by this Act)—
(a) continue in accordance with its terms; and
(b) be taken to be an appointment as a police security officer under
Part 9A of the Police Act 1998; and
(c) be subject to the same conditions or limitations (including, to avoid
doubt, limitations of duties or powers) as applied in relation to the person's
appointment immediately before the commencement of this section.
(2) To avoid doubt, subsection (1) applies in relation to an
appointment that is, immediately before the commencement of this section,
suspended under the Protective Security Act 2007.
(3) The continuation of an appointment under this section will be taken
not to amount to an interruption of service (however described).
(4) Any rights, entitlements or liabilities accrued by a person whose
appointment is continued under this section will be taken not to be affected by
the operation of this section.
57—Suspension of protective security officer to
continue
(1) If the
appointment of a protective security officer is, immediately before the
commencement of this section, suspended under the Protective Security
Act 2007, the suspension—
(a) will continue in accordance with its terms; and
(b) will be taken to be a suspension under Part 9A of the Police
Act 1998.
(2) A determination of the Commissioner under section 36 of the
Protective Security Act 2007 relating to a suspension referred in
subsection (1)—
(a) will continue in accordance with its terms; and
(b) will be taken to be a determination of the Commissioner under
section 70 of the Police Act 1998.
58—Identification of protective security officers
taken to satisfy section 63I of Police
Act 1998
An identity card issued to a protective security officer under
section 32 of the Protective Security Act 2007 (being an
officer whose appointment is continued under section 56) will be taken to
be an identity card issued under, and to comply with, section 63I of the
Police Act 1998.
59—Continuation of determinations of protected
persons, places or vehicles
A determination made by the Minister under section 4 of the
Protective Security Act 2007 and in force immediately before the
commencement of this section—
(a) will, on the commencement of this section, continue in accordance with
its terms; and
(b) will be taken to be a determination made by the Minister under
section 63B of the Police Act 1998.
60—Continuation of certain
orders
A general or special order made by the Commissioner under section 9 of
the Protective Security Act 2007 and in force immediately before the
commencement of this section—
(a) will, on the commencement of this section, continue in accordance with
its terms; and
(b) will be taken to be a general or special order (as the case requires)
made or given by the Commissioner under section 11 of the Police
Act 1998.
61—Continuation of certain directions of Police
Minister
A direction given by the Police Minister to the Commissioner under the
Protective Security Act 2007 and in force immediately before the
commencement of this section—
(a) will, on the commencement of this section, continue in accordance with
its terms; and
(b) will be taken to be a direction of the Minister given to the
Commissioner under the Police Act 1998.
62—Continuation of determination of structure of
ranks
A determination of the Commissioner under section 11 of the
Protective Security Act 2007 and in force immediately before the
commencement of this section—
(a) will, on the commencement of this section, continue in accordance with
its terms; and
(b) will be taken to be a determination of the Commissioner under
section 63F of the Police Act 1998.
63—Continuation of certain directions of protective
security officers
A direction given by a protective security officer under Part 4 of the
Protective Security Act 2007 and in force immediately before the
commencement of this section—
(a) will, on the commencement of this section, continue in accordance with
its terms; and
(b) will be taken to be a direction of a police security officer under
Part 9A Division 4 of the Police Act 1998.
64—Continuation of custody of certain objects and
substances
An object or substance detained under section 18 of the Protective
Security Act 2007 and in the custody of a police officer immediately
before the commencement of this section—
(a) may, on the commencement of this section, continue to be detained in
the custody of the police officer; and
(b) will be taken to have been detained and handed over into the custody
of the police officer under section 63R of the Police
Act 1998.
